About Silvia Masciarelli
Silvia Masciarelli is a scholar working on Cancer Research, Cell Biology and Physiology, having authored 42 papers that have together received 1.5k indexed citations. Recurring topics across this work include MicroRNA in disease regulation (7 papers), Endoplasmic Reticulum Stress and Disease (7 papers) and RNA Research and Splicing (6 papers). The work is most often cited by research in Cancer Research (306 citations), Cell Biology (287 citations) and Molecular Biology (943 citations). Silvia Masciarelli has collaborated with scholars based in Italy, Germany and United States. Frequent co-authors include Francesco Fazi, Roberto Sitia, Giulia Fontemaggi, Giovanni Blandino, Sun Hee Park, Chengyu Liu, Alessandro Fatica, Taku Nedachi, Catherine Jin and Marco Conti. Their work appears in journals such as Journal of Clinical Investigation, The EMBO Journal and PLoS ONE.
